To clean a window AC unit, follow these essential steps:
- Unplug the unit from the power source for safety.
- Remove the front cover, usually clipped or screwed on, to access the air filter behind it.
- Clean the air filter by washing it in warm soapy water with mild dish detergent. Rinse thoroughly and let it air dry completely before reinserting.
- Remove the unit from the window if necessary to access the coils.
- Clean the evaporator coil (inside) and condenser coil (outside) gently with a soft brush and a mild soap solution. For the condenser coil, a gentle spray with a garden hose can be used without bending the fins.
- Straighten any bent fins using a fin comb or a gentle tool like a butter knife.
- Clean the blower fan (inside) and the condenser fan (outside) by removing dust with a soft brush or vacuum with a brush attachment.
- Clean the drain pan thoroughly with soap and water, ensuring the drain hole is clear.
- Wipe down the inside and outside surfaces of the unit.
- Allow all parts to dry completely before reassembling and plugging the unit back in.
Regular cleaning, especially of the air filter and coils, helps maintain efficiency and air quality, reduces mold and mildew buildup, and prolongs your window AC's lifespan.
